Reflective optics for cosine-corrected irradiance measurements

Review of Scientific Instruments, 1998
Most of the detectors commonly used for radiometric measurements have a more or less poor cosine response. By means of a reflective entrance optics in front of the detection system, we have reduced relative cosine errors below 5% up to zenith angles of 75°.

Distance Weighted Cosine Similarity Measure for Text Classification

2013
In Vector Space Model, Cosine is widely used to measure the similarity between two vectors. Its calculation is very efficient, especially for sparse vectors, as only the non-zero dimensions need to be considered.
